Stage | Description |
---|---|
Eligibility: | Hold a Bachelor's degree in Microbiology, Biotechnology, Life Sciences, or a related field with good academic standing. Some universities may specify minimum marks. |
Entrance Exams: | Two main options: - University-specific exams: Many universities conduct their own admission tests focusing on core microbiology concepts, biotechnology applications, and general aptitude. - National exams: GATE (Graduate Aptitude Test in Engineering) with Microbiology/Biotechnology specialization, JNU CEEB (Jawaharlal Nehru University Centre for Ecological Sciences Entrance Examination), or BHU PET (Banaras Hindu University Postgraduate Entrance Test) are accepted by some universities. |
Selection Process: | Based on a combination of entrance exam scores and interview performance. Some universities may also consider academic projects, research experience, or personal statements. |
Merit List and Admission: | Candidates ranked highest on the merit list are offered admission, considering both entrance exam scores and interview performance. The number of available seats also plays a role. |
Application Timeline: | Typically, applications open in December/January for the following academic year (July/August start). Deadlines may vary by university. |
Application Fees: | Vary depending on the university and entrance exam. Typically range from INR 500 to INR 2000. |

Subject | Description |
---|---|
Fundamentals of Microbiology: | Introduces the basic principles of microbiology, covering microbial diversity, structure, and function. |
Microbial Metabolism: | Explores the biochemical pathways and energy transformations that underpin microbial life, including respiration, fermentation, and photosynthesis. |
Microbial Growth and Taxonomy: | Discusses the factors influencing microbial growth, as well as the classification and identification of microorganisms. |
Microbial Genetics and Biotechnology: | Delve into the principles of microbial genetics, including DNA replication, transcription, and translation, and their applications in biotechnology. |
Bacteriology: | Explores the diversity and characteristics of bacteria, including morphology, classification, physiology, and pathogenicity. |
Mycology: | Provides an in-depth understanding of fungi, covering their diversity, structure, metabolism, and applications in biotechnology and medicine. |
Virology: | Introduces the world of viruses, including their structure, replication, classification, and impact on human health. |
Microbial Ecology and Environmental Microbiology: | Examines the interactions and roles of microbes in the environment, including ecosystems, bioremediation, and pollution control. |
Medical Microbiology and Infection Control: | Explores the causes, diagnosis, and treatment of microbial diseases, emphasizing infection control strategies and public health measures. |
Food Microbiology: | Analyzes the role of microbes in food spoilage, foodborne diseases, and food preservation techniques. |
Microbial Biotechnology and Applications: | Investigates the potential of microbes in various applications, including bioremediation, biofuel production, and development of novel therapeutic agents. |
Microbial Fermentation: | Studies the principles and applications of microbial fermentation in food, pharmaceutical, and industrial processes. |
Microbial Biosensors and Bioprocess Engineering: | Explores the design and development of microbial biosensors for environmental monitoring and bioprocess engineering. |
Dissertation/Project: | Conduct independent research in a chosen area of applied microbiology, applying knowledge and skills to address a real-world problem. |
